North Dakota OKS Black Box restrictions
North Dakota made the first step in dealing with legal issues around the vehicle “black boxes”, with the adoption of a law that requires manufacturers to inform buyers on the burner and prevents insurance companies and of repression by using data recorder.
Event-data recorder (EDR) that the black boxes are officially called, information such as vehicle speed, brakes, steering, airbag installation and even if the driver was wearing a belt.
The law of North Dakota is the first of several black box that laws on national legislators to occur. Dir John Hoeven is expected to sign Senate Bill 2200, that producers and distributors to say whether the buyer of a vehicle is an EDR and what are its capabilities - including the ability to transmit data.
